Hi Ed, was wondering if you could sum up our attacking options the press seem to be going wild at the moment? Dembele, zapata, arnuatovic, sulemana, Danjuma and I've seen who've said about the lad at Montpellier. Are we likely to see more than one? I'd personally love danjuma, dembele and sulemana but I doubt three will happen. Is there any truth in any of these Ed?

{Ed002's Note - Arnaut Danjuma (W) Aston Villa are keen on the player but not the €35M Villareal require for the transfer. Newcastle have a declared interest. I am not aware of any proposal for Everton to sign him on loan with an option to buy but he is a player that FL looked at for Chelsea - Villareal will sell if the asking price is met so Everton have an option. West Ham, Aston Vill and Bournemouth provide options. Nottingham forest enquired.
Moussa Dembele (S) Prior interest of Manchester United has likely gone as he will be able to talk to non-French sides in January. This will spark the interest of Galatasaray who may be signing Seferovic but will be letting Icardi go. Everton may offer an option but it makes no sense for the plyer to move in January.
Duvan Zapata (S) Atalanta will sell or loan with an obligation to buy - nothing else. Will be hard to shift.
Marko Arnautovic (S) Not aware of any approach by Everton.
Kamaldeen Sulemana (LW) Rennes will let Sulemana move on in order to keep Martin Terrier and to raise funds. Not having an agent killed off the chance of a move to Ajax last year. Rennes will let him leave on a loan with an obligation to buy deal. Option to Elye Wahi for Everton and an option to Alex Baena for Nice.}
